Slate backsplash installation involves fitting and securing slate tiles onto kitchen or bathroom walls to create a durable and visually appealing surface. This service typically includes preparing the wall surface, measuring and cutting tiles to fit specific spaces, and carefully applying adhesive to ensure the tiles are securely in place. Skilled contractors focus on achieving a seamless, professional look while ensuring the backsplash can withstand daily use, moisture, and heat. Proper installation not only enhances the aesthetic appeal but also helps protect the wall behind sinks and stoves from water damage and stains.
Many homeowners turn to slate backsplash installation to address common problems such as chipped or stained existing tiles, outdated designs, or damaged wall surfaces. A new slate backsplash can serve as a practical upgrade that improves the overall look of a kitchen or bathroom. It also provides a protective barrier against spills, splashes, and humidity, making cleaning easier and reducing the likelihood of mold or water damage. The overview below groups typical Slate Backsplash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in York, SC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or backsplash repairs or replacements in York, SC range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ope and materials involved.
Standard Backsplash Installation - Installing a new tile backsplash in a standard kitchen usually costs between $1,000 and $2,500. Most projects in this category are straightforward and fall within this typical range.
Full Backsplash Replacement - Larger, more complex projects, such as complete kitchen overhauls, can reach $3,500-$5,000 or more. Fewer projects push into this high tier, often due to custom designs or extensive prep work.
Material and Design Variations - Costs can vary widely based on tile choice and design complexity, with premium materials potentially increasing expenses beyond typical ranges. Local contractors can provide estimates based on specific preferences and project details.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
